What Is LifeTogether Version 0.2?
LifeTogether is an indie life simulation game that puts players in control of a character navigating everyday routines. The version 0.2 build represents an alpha-stage release, meaning the game is still very much a work in progress. Nexora Inc has been transparent about this, reminding players that many core mechanics found in full releases — such as employment, bill payments, and survival meters — are not yet implemented.
The current build focuses on establishing a foundation of domestic activities. Players can sleep, cook meals, and now watch television, which was added as part of the recent update cycle. The developer has signaled that the real, feature-complete version is targeting a 2025 release window.

What Is New in the Latest Alpha Patch
The most recent iteration — LifeTogether version 0.2.8 — introduced a handful of quality-of-life additions that expand what players can do during a typical in-game day. The standout addition is the ability to watch TV, giving players another way to pass time indoors. This might sound minor, but in a game built around daily routines, every new activity adds texture to the experience.
Pizza delivery also made its way into this build, allowing players to order food rather than relying solely on cooking. Community reports suggest this feature works as a straightforward menu interaction, though the variety of available toppings and delivery times may still be limited at this stage.
One quirky detail worth noting: players have reported encountering a mysterious crystal object in the game world. The developer has explicitly advised ignoring it, as it does not serve any functional purpose in the current build. Similarly, a notification referencing a daily bill amount of $15 appears in-game, but no actual payment system exists yet — it is essentially a placeholder teasing future economic mechanics.
What Players Can Expect in Upcoming Updates
Nexora Inc has shared a brief roadmap of features slated for future alpha and beta builds. While no specific dates have been confirmed, the developer has listed two items as "coming soon": a BBQ cooking station and a functional toilet. Both additions would round out the domestic simulation experience, giving players more ways to manage their character's needs and home environment.

The pattern suggests Nexora Inc is layering systems incrementally. Rather than dropping a massive overhaul, the developer appears to be adding one or two features per patch, testing stability, and gathering player feedback before moving to the next set of mechanics.
